

eG Enterprise and DX Performance Management compete in the IT monitoring and management category. eG Enterprise seems to have the upper hand in customer service and affordability, while DX Performance Management excels in reporting and integration capabilities.
Features: eG Enterprise provides comprehensive monitoring with a single pane of glass, offering in-depth visibility across the entire Citrix environment and the ability to diagnose issues from alerts. It integrates infrastructure monitoring, user behavior analysis, and all aspects into one console while supporting quick test implementation. DX Performance Management delivers a comprehensive monitoring experience with consolidated views and customizable dashboards. It is recognized for its ability to integrate data from multiple sources and for the ease of developing cohesive reports.
Room for Improvement: Users of eG Enterprise express a need for improvements in user interface navigation, cost-effectiveness, and expanded monitoring capabilities for newer platforms like OpenShift. The interface could be more intuitive, and initial configuration can be challenging. DX Performance Management users highlight the need for improved reporting, streamlined configuration, and better support for high availability. Enhancing alerting severity and granularity is also suggested.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Both eG Enterprise and DX Performance Management offer on-premises deployment. eG Enterprise is praised for exceptional customer service and responsive support, although some users have experienced response delays. DX Performance Management is commended for efficient support and a structured technical assistance approach, but users note it lacks eG's personalized customer engagement.
Pricing and ROI: eG Enterprise offers cost-effective solutions with flexible licensing models, making it affordable and highlighting a proven return on investment through reduced operational costs and fewer service requests. DX Performance Management is perceived as higher-priced but provides significant value with bundled offerings and comprehensive support. Its straightforward licensing is viewed as a good value, especially for larger implementations, resulting in substantial ROI despite higher initial costs.

DX Performance Management is a comprehensive solution for network performance, health, and capacity monitoring. It facilitates baselining, trending, and real-time visibility, aiding in capacity planning and incident alerting. It integrates with services like NetFlow, NFA, and ADA, supporting multiple device types. Its database performance allows for efficient analysis with scalability across different device counts, while customizable dashboards provide a single-pane-of-glass view for network insights.
What are the key features of DX Performance Management?Network service providers implement DX Performance Management to deliver in-depth insights, monitoring routers and switches for SNMP data collection, aiding CPU, memory, and interface utilization analysis. It's integrated with network fault management and service desks, providing comprehensive performance analytics.

eG Enterprise provides a robust platform that integrates monitoring and diagnostics capabilities for diverse IT landscapes. Users benefit from a centralized view of applications and infrastructure, bolstered by visual topology maps and intuitive data presentation. The auto-configuration feature ensures efficient setup, while its AI-based automation drives superior data analysis and insights. Though challenges exist in interface modernization and configuration complexity, its scalability and real user experience insights make it a strong contender for IT management. Companies place high value on its seamless integration with ITSM and ability to track user behavior, despite some limitations in OpenShift and complex backend configurations.
